Managed IT Services vs. In-House IT: Making the Right Choice
When making a choice between IT management solutions and internal IT departments, organizations must assess their specific requirements, resources, and strategic objectives. IT management solutions offer a scalable solution, allowing businesses to get access to a wide variety of skills without the overhead of employing a dedicated team. Providers often offer 24/7 support, preventive care, and access to the latest technology, which can be especially beneficial for small and mid-sized companies that may not have the budget to maintain an extensive internal staff.
On the other hand, an in-house IT team can provide a deeper understanding of the company's particular processes and culture. This intimate knowledge can foster quicker decisions and custom solutions to address organizational needs immediately. Additionally, maintaining a full-time team on-site can enhance collaboration and collaboration, making it easier to implement modifications rapidly. However, recruiting and retaining skilled IT professionals can be costly, and ongoing training may be required to keep up with technological advancements.
Ultimately, the choice between outsourced IT management and internal IT should align with a business's operational goals and financial factors. Companies looking for flexibility and access to a wide range of skills may benefit outsourcing their IT needs, while those who value direct control and customized support might prefer maintaining an in-house staff. Assessing current needs and projecting future growth will help leaders make an educated decision that promotes creativity and efficiency.
Boosting Cybersecurity and Cloud Infrastructure
As organizations more and more utilize online services, strengthening cybersecurity has become paramount. Organizations must implement robust safeguards to protect sensitive data from increasing cyber threats. This includes employing advanced firewall systems, routine software updates, and utilizing multi-factor authentication. By integrating these practices, companies can substantially reduce risks and safeguard their cloud environment, providing safe data retention and operations.
Cloud computing offers flexibility and expandability, but it also presents specific cybersecurity challenges. Organizations must prioritize security during cloud transitions to eliminate vulnerabilities that can be manipulated by cybercriminals. This involves conducting comprehensive assessments of cloud service providers, verifying they comply with regulatory standards and rules. Additionally, it is crucial to develop a robust data protection strategy including encryption and proper access controls to boost the security posture while using cloud resources.
Moreover, establishing a climate of cybersecurity awareness among employees is important. Regular training sessions can help staff recognize potential threats and follow best practices for cybersecurity. Organizations should also create processes for regular security audits to discover and rectify weaknesses in their infrastructure. By promoting a proactive cybersecurity culture, organizations can strengthen their defenses, making sure both their IT services and cloud environments remain strong against emerging cyber threats.
